There are many recommended attractions suitable for tourism in Xinjiang in August, here are some highlights:?
Recommended attractions:?
Sayram Lake: Known as "the last tear of the Atlantic Ocean", with breathtaking lake and mountain scenery?
Kanas: One of the most beautiful lakes in China, a perfect combination of natural scenery and cultural landscapes, like a fairyland on earth?
Duku Highway: A magnificent experience of driving through the Tianshan Mountains, experiencing four seasons in one day with ever-changing scenery?
Nalati Grassland: One of the four major grasslands in the world, the grassland scenery is breathtaking?
Kalajun Grassland: The most beautiful 3D grassland, vast and boundless, a visual feast?
Xiata Ancient Road: One of the top three hiking routes in Xinjiang, with a long history and unique scenery?
Yizhao Highway: Picturesque scenery, crossing mountains and grasslands, known as the "Little Duku"?
Other attractions worth visiting:?
Qiaxi: Scenic and picturesque, suitable for hiking adventures, like a forest grassland hidden in a painting scroll?
Tangbula Grassland: It has the reputation of being a "hundred-mile-long scroll, natural gallery"?
Yili Valley National Forest Park: A natural oxygen bar with dense forests and clear streams?
Zhaosu Grassland: In August, the grassland is blooming with various wildflowers, breathtakingly beautiful, and you can also experience the joy of horse riding?
Gongnais National Nature Reserve: Rich in natural landscapes and wildlife resources?
Baihaba: Located on the border between China and Kazakhstan, with fairy tale-like town buildings and scenery?
Colorful Beach: The most beautiful Yadan landform in Xinjiang, a colorful riverbank formed by millions of years of wind and rain erosion and river erosion?
Travel precautions:?
Some attractions in Xinjiang may be crowded in August, it is recommended to plan your itinerary and book accommodations in advance?
Pay attention to sunscreen and hydration, as Xinjiang’s summer sun is intense and the climate is dry?
Respect local folk culture and customs, especially when visiting ethnic minority inhabited areas?
